What is quantitative trading? quantitative algorithmic trading: automated execution of trades using computer programs and quantitative models leverages data science to identify profitable opportunities based on: statistical patterns historical data real time market signals. Artificial intelligence (ai) and machine learning (ml) are transforming the domain of quantitative trading (qt) through the deployment of advanced algorithms capable of sifting through extensive financial datasets to pinpoint lucrative investment openings.
